Output 3bc65a4a90aae5c2431315f79ffb5f96a108bc197406f42b3ecd5af6ca7f8ca3:6

value
1046636909
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c29a3e404b6911c178129b805a99b487935bbeb OP_EQUALVERIFY OP_CHECKSIG
address
LWYTwDEJFEvhwgQzW2GYS2XTGtLv8ay6px
transaction
3bc65a4a90aae5c2431315f79ffb5f96a108bc197406f42b3ecd5af6ca7f8ca3
spent
true